Determinants of trimetrexate lethality in human colon cancer cells

Trimetrexate (TMQ) exhibits differential cytotoxicity in colon cancer cells. Prolonged dihydrofolate reductase (DHFR) inhibition and DNA damage after TMQ removal predict cell lethality, not just initial growth inhibition.

Area of Science:

  • Biochemistry
  • Molecular Biology
  • Cancer Research

Background:

  • Trimetrexate (TMQ) is a lipophilic antifolate drug.
  • Colon carcinoma cell lines SNU-C4 and NCI-H630 exhibit varying sensitivity to TMQ.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To investigate the cytotoxicity and biochemical mechanisms of TMQ in two human colon carcinoma cell lines.
  • To correlate biochemical effects with differential cell sensitivity to TMQ.

Main Methods:

  • Exposure of SNU-C4 and NCI-H630 cells to varying concentrations of TMQ.
  • Assays for cell growth, clonogenic survival, and DNA damage (pH step alkaline elution).
  • Enzyme activity assays for dihydrofolate reductase (DHFR) and thymidylate synthase.

Main Results:

  • TMQ inhibited cell growth similarly in both lines at low concentrations, but higher concentrations (1-10 microM) caused significant lethality only in SNU-C4 cells.
  • Biochemical effects like DHFR inhibition and nucleotide depletion were initially similar, but TMQ caused more DNA damage in SNU-C4 cells.
  • Persistent DHFR inhibition after drug removal correlated with lethality in SNU-C4 cells, while DHFR recovered in NCI-H630 cells.

Conclusions:

  • DHFR inhibition during TMQ exposure causes growth inhibition, but prolonged DHFR inhibition and DNA damage after drug removal are better predictors of cell lethality.
  • Differential sensitivity of colon cancer cells to TMQ is linked to the duration of DHFR inhibition and the extent of DNA damage post-exposure.
